Caitlyn Stumps For Donald Trump: 'Republicans Will Bring This Country Back!'

Former Ted Cruz fan Caitlyn Jenner has not officially endorsed Donald Trump, but she showed increasing support for the Republican Party on Wednesday.

Appearing on Bill Simmons' HBO show Any Given Wednesday, Jenner opened up about her struggles with coming out as transgender and got into a passionate political discussion with the host.

Simmons brought up Jenner's status as a staunch conservative and she said, "I believe in the simple things. I believe in our constitution." The reality star went on to say that although she had been disappointed in Republicans over the "last 10, 20 years," she believes that the party has a "better opportunity to bring this country back to what it was."

When asked if she supported Trump officially, Jenner said "No, I have not outwardly supported anybody… I am here to help the entire Republican Party do a better job when it comes to LGBT issues."

Jenner famously praised the GOP presidential nominee for his statements against the controversial North Carolina transgender bathroom law in April. She even recorded a video of herself using a Trump Tower bathroom after Trump invited her to freely use his facilities.

And, Jenner showed up in Cleveland last month during the Republican National Convention to speak at a breakfast Q&A and joked, "Maybe we should ban Republican representatives at the state level from being in bathrooms!"
